






秃比不是小刘鸭Vietnam is a place where coffee beans are produced, so coffee shops can be found everywhere in the streets and alleys. It is really good news for coffee lovers, and the prices are so cheap!
The place is very large and industrial-style. There are cafes, coffee classrooms, coffee bean sales areas, and coffee beans in sacks can be seen everywhere. It is simply a factory store.
Affogato is 35,000 Vietnamese dong, which is a little over 10 yuan. It is espresso with coconut ice cream. The coconut ice cream is full of pulp, and the slightly sweet taste and the bitterness of espresso are well neutralized. It tastes good! It is worthy of being a signature.
Latte is 40,000 Vietnamese dong, which is also about 10 yuan. The hot cup is relatively small, equivalent to a small cup in China, and the latte art is quite delicate.
Flan egg pudding, 25,000 Vietnamese dong, less than 10 yuan. I originally wanted tiramisu cake, but unfortunately the store was sold out. I just ordered a pudding, which tasted like caramel pudding.
Two cups of coffee and a dessert cost only a little over 30 yuan, which is more than you can buy in China. The price-performance ratio is so touching!

A very beautiful coffee shop, you can post any picture of it on social media. The staff is very friendly and patient. If you want to learn how to make coffee, you can ask them and they will teach you. The only downside is that there are not many choices of cakes in the shop. The coffee is already delicious, and it would be even more perfect if there were more cakes.
The environment is very good and the coffee is good. A creative shop worth visiting
I don't know much about coffee, but I was attracted by the environment here. My husband is a coffee fanatic and he praised this place highly. But if you come here, it's best to wear long sleeves, it's quite empty and there are many mosquitoes.
The whole store is a coffee bean factory, with many machines for roasting coffee beans. You can visit and drink coffee, which I think is very good and scientific.
